Africa’s biggest youth event, The Future Awards Africa has announced
the ambassadors for the 10th anniversary – a stellar cast of past
winners of the awards across business, development, governance and the
creative industries.
The 10 selected ambassadors are international recording artiste
Bukonla ‘Asa’ Elemide (Nigeria), music producer Michel ‘Don Jazzy’ Ajere
(Nigeria), beauty entrepreneur Tara Fela Durotoye (Nigeria), founder of
LEAP Africa Ndidi Nwuneli (Nigeria), agriculture entrepreneur Nnaemeka
Ikeguonu (Nigeria), activist Sangu Delle (Ghana), power entrepreneur
Patrick Ngowi (Tanzania), singer Diamond Platinumz (Tanzania),
change-maker Fogblanbenchi Lily Harity (Cameroon), and lawmaker Oramait
Alengoil (Uganda).
The ambassadors will drive the 10th year anniversary campaign for the
awards across TV, radio, online and through targeted events targeted at
galvanizing the global TFAA brain trust to solve problems across
Africa.
As part of the 10th anniversary #AfricaNeedsYou campaign, TFAA
launched a 100-city tour to build 100 hubs across the continent over the
next one year. The hubs will partner with local non-governmental
organisations to solve problems community by community. It will be
launched officially at the awards this year on 6, December 2015.
The Future Awards Africa 2015 is powered by RED and held in
partnership with the Ford Foundation, Microsoft, the US Consulate, the
Canadian High Commission Nigeria and The Tony Elumelu Foundation.
